WebThe Ballad of the White Horse (Version 3) G. K. Chesterton (1874 - 1936) This epic poem is about Alfred the Great's defense of Christian England against the pagan Viking invaders. The decisive battle is fought in sight of a white horse mark made on a hill, after which the poem is named.
